A Much Deeper Dive: Specialized Cleansing Offerings

The true value of an expert service cleaner depend on their capability to deal with the often-overlooked, yet vital, elements of center maintenance. For circumstances, carpet cleaning isn't almost running a vacuum over it; it involves deep extraction methods that remove embedded dirt, allergens, and even odors that regular vacuuming just can't touch. This substantially extends the life of your carpeting, conserving you substantial replacement expenses down the line. Window cleansing, particularly for high-rise buildings, requires specific equipment and qualified personnel to ensure streak-free clarity without running the risk of security. It's not merely about visual appeals; clean windows enable more natural light to permeate, reducing dependence on artificial lighting and potentially lowering energy costs. And what about those often-forgotten locations?

  • Floor Stripping and Waxing: Necessary for tough surfaces, this process gets rid of old wax and grime accumulation, then uses fresh coats, restoring shine and safeguarding the flooring from wear and tear. This is especially vital in high-traffic locations.
  • Disinfection Services: Beyond routine cleaning, especially in today's environment, a robust disinfection procedure is paramount. This includes utilizing EPA-approved disinfectants on high-touch surfaces, substantially decreasing the spread of bacteria and infections. It's an investment in the health of your staff members and clients alike.
  • Post-Construction Clean-up: A specialized service that handles the typically tremendous dust, debris, and sticking around messes after a renovation or brand-new develop. This requires a different method than routine cleaning, frequently including industrial-grade devices.
  • Upholstery Cleaning: Office chairs, waiting room couches-- they collect dirt and allergens with time. Professional upholstery cleansing not just makes them look better but also improves indoor air quality.

When vetting potential workplace cleaning company, look into their staff training procedures. Are their employees background-checked and properly trained in the current cleaning techniques and safety treatments? Do they comprehend the subtleties of different surfaces and the proper cleaning representatives to use? A cleaner utilizing the incorrect chemical on a fragile surface can cause irreparable damage, turning a simple cleansing job into a pricey repair. It's not just about wielding a mop; it has to do with knowledge and accuracy. Look for business that invest in their personnel, offering continuous training and ensuring they are up-to-date on market finest practices. This dedication to professional advancement frequently associates straight with the quality of service you get.
